The lead story in the November 2005 National Geographic asked, “What if I said you could add up to ten years to your life?” The lead article in the July 24, 2013, Newsweek was even more audaciously titled: “You can life forever: Is immortality plausible? Or is it quack science?” Well, perhaps we can extend our lives, even by 10 years or so, but immortality seems a bit of a stretch.
